Replacing windows involves a few variables that influence the total project cost. The biggest factor is the material you select, such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ass, as well as the style of window, like double-hung versus casement. The condition of your existing frames matters, too; if there is hidden rot or water damage, that requires extra labor to fix. Choosing triple-pane glass for better insulation or adding decorative grids will also shift the final number. Your exact pricing is confirmed free on the call.

Absolutely. Impact-resistant glass is highly recommended for hurricane protection in Port St. Lucie. Energy-efficient features, like low-E coatings, are also vital for managing the intense Florida heat and reducing cooling costs. These features offer significant benefits.
The time required depends on the scope of the project. Installing a single window might take a few hours, while a full home replacement could take several days. The team that comes out will provide a more accurate estimate. They work efficiently to minimize disruption.
